In the last few months, you may have noticed Ad Hoc frequently in the news not only across your regions, but also within the national media. We have been talking about how Property Guardianship is an increasing answer to high priced rentals, how it can assist local communities to securely fill empty buildings, and how it is an opportunity to live in commercial properties you would ordinarily never get the chance to live in.
